COLUMBIA, S.C. (WIS) - The No. 11 South Carolina Gamecocks will look to open SEC play with a win over Vanderbilt on Saturday at Williams-Brice Stadium.

Here’s what to know ahead of the game:

WHAT TIME IS KICKOFF? WHERE CAN I WATCH?

The game is scheduled to kick off at 7:45 p.m. and will be broadcast on the SEC Network.

THE STREAK

The Gamecocks come into Saturday having won 16 straight games against the Commodores and 23 of the last 25 meetings. South Carolina is 30-4 against Vandy all-time.

HOT START NEEDED?

South Carolina will look to get off to a hotter start than in last week’s game against South Carolina State. After an over-two-hour weather delay, the Gamecocks used two punt return touchdowns by Vicari Swain as a spark to get past the FCS Bulldogs.
